Role: Enhanced Care Health Care Support Worker
The role of the Enhanced Care Health Care Support Worker is to support recovery and provide care to those people who have enhanced care needs across the organisation, ensuring that the care experienced is positive and that the person’s safety is maintained.
To deliver enhanced care across wards and departments to patients who have been assessed as needing additional support due to:

  • Dementia
  • Delirium
  • Mental health conditions
  • Challenging behaviour
  • Physical health conditions that compromise the safety of the patient and/or others.
    Enhanced care is an integral part of a therapeutic plan and ensures safe and sensitive monitoring of a patient's physical and psychological wellbeing while building therapeutic relationships. Enhanced care could involve supporting a group of patients or providing one-to-one support.
    The post holder is expected to treat everyone (patients, their relatives, visitors, colleagues, etc.) with respect, dignity, courtesy, and in accordance with the Trust’s values.
    Demonstrate an understanding of the care and treatment programmes for people with enhanced care needs, enabling instruction, advice, and guidance for patients, families, and carers. Make appropriate adjustments independently (within own competence and skill set) and communicate any changes to patients and registered health care professionals.
    Develop and maintain meaningful therapeutic relationships with individuals. Adopt a polite, positive, and empathetic approach, communicating effectively and informatively. Assess situations, identify and resolve potential problems within own competence and skill set. Assist in dealing with verbal/physical aggression using de-escalation techniques.
    Provide one-to-one support and/or supervision for individuals or groups under the supervision/direction of registered health care professionals, within a delegated framework for agreed tasks. Organise a range of activities, facilitating meaningful activities for individuals and liaising with the multi-disciplinary team to coordinate patient-specific activities and daily plans in line with risk assessments. Exercise a degree of independence, initiative, and judgment, considering different approaches when delivering tasks.
    Maidstone and Tunbridge Wells NHS Trust ranks among the top 10 NHS Trusts nationwide and was named the second-best Trust to work for in the South East in the 2023 and 2024 NHS Staff Survey.
    We are a large acute hospital trust in south-east England, providing general hospital services and specialist care to around 600,000 residents in West Kent and East Sussex. With a dedicated and diverse team of over 8,000 staff, we are proud to offer specialised cancer services to over two million people through the Kent Oncology Centre.
    Fordcombe Hospital, near Tunbridge Wells, became part of the Trust in October 2024. Specialising in planned care, it offers:
  • Two operating theatres
  • 28 inpatient and day-care beds
  • Diagnostic services (X-ray, MRI, CT, and endoscopy)
  • Consultation/treatment rooms
